Holla'back Records,Entertainment & Management,LLC

Holla'back Records was established in August of 1997. Its President and CEO, Carla "The Commissiona" Boone decided to start this Independent label after 20 + years of working in corporate America. It was time that Carla define her own destiny; thus Holla'back Records was borne.

With the expertise of her Executive Vice President, Shanna "Cookie "McCollum, controlling, coordinating and directing major activities relating to managing the "Holla'back Project", Holla'back Records successfully released its first project Holla'back Records presents "Trajik" and "the Black Casba."

Now, in the new millenium, we are proud to introduce the first soloist signed to the label: Kevlar, formerly of the Black Casba & to reintroduce "Trajik!"

"Trajik," is a derivative of Webster dictionary's "Tragedy." Webster defines tragedy as "the downfall of a great man." Far too many of our great African American men and women have fallen prey to the tragedy of life; unable to absorb and appreciate its good and bad.Trajik acts as an outlet for our young people. "We are the voice of the streets; of every young man and woman struggling through this thing we call life" states Kieon, the spokesman of the group."We write, perform and live despite tragedy and hope that all of our young brothers and sisters can, eventually, do the same!" The 2 members of Trajik include Kieon (a 20 year old actor, rapper& part-time model) and Ant-Live (a 19 year old hip hop junkie!) Together, they form the hottest new hip hop idols in the game today!

The Black Casba, featured Holla'back's first solo artist: KEVLAR!! The technical definition of Kevlar is "a bulletproff material made by Dupont." Kevlar's rap style reflects the true technical definition just described: simply Bulletproof!

Kevlar, formerly of the Black Casba, is featured on the featured track "the Black Casba." Kevlar's unique style and sheer rap genius will captivate all real hip hop enthusiasts! Kevlar, a 20 year old cat from BK, has been influenced by old school artists such as Big L & Rakim.
